A LOW COST REMOTE DATA ACQUISITION SYSTEM BASED ON INTERNET AND MICROCONTROLLER FOR WIND MEASUREMENT

There are more and more demands for measuring variables in various engineering activities and collecting the measurement data from distant observation sites such as wind measurements from different far-away masts. In turn, a remote data acquisition system is required for such various customized tasks. It is a fact that microcontrollers featuring high-performance I/O hardware and software are quite flexibly developed in product markets while Internet technology is now available and easily accessible for a world-wide network. For a technical contribution, this paper presents the complete development of a low cost, easy to implement, remote data acquisition system embedded on a microcontroller so as to gain measurement data from remote measurement sites through the Internet network with the techniques on the Transmission Communication Protocol/Internet Protocol (TCP/IP) and File Transfer Protocol (FTP). Additionally, the experimental results of real-time implementation show that the proposed techniques have not only been flexibly developed byusingan available low-cost microcontroller but also are feasible with current Internet traffic for acquiring any remote measurement data where an Internet connection is available.
